Output 4c38a16b5c1315072ea4561ecffc86801823fbf78faca39a58e7387c57c1bc4c:0

value
2555803
script pubkey
OP_0 OP_PUSHBYTES_20 c3b7df86dea122f3443dc32c543e4954fcdfe553
address
bc1qcwmalpk75y30x3pacvk9g0jf2n7dle2n0fmtzp
transaction
4c38a16b5c1315072ea4561ecffc86801823fbf78faca39a58e7387c57c1bc4c
confirmations
296041
spent
true